Materials for Making Recycled Art

When it comes to making recycled art, the possibilities are endless. You can use almost any type of material, from paper and cardboard to plastic and metal. Here are some of the most common materials you can use to make recycled art:

• Paper: Paper is one of the most versatile materials for making recycled art. You can use it to make collages, sculptures, and even origami.

• Cardboard: Cardboard is a great material for making 3D sculptures and other art projects. It’s also lightweight and easy to work with.
